HPのデザインをいろいろといじってみたくてCSSのお勉強をしてて始めて知った驚愕の事実!!
div を使ってブロック要素でレイアウトをいじってたんだけど、
このときのwidthがdiv枠の幅じゃなくてdiv枠からpaddingの値を引いた値(内容物の幅)になるんだね!!
今までdiv枠全体の幅だと思ってたよorz
しかもIEだとdiv枠全体の幅と解釈されるらしいのでHTMLソースの先頭できちんとDOCTYPEを指定してやら無いといけないらしい。
う~~~ん・・・・奥が深い;;
HPのデザインをいろいろといじってみたくてCSSのお勉強をしてて始めて知った驚愕の事実!!
div を使ってブロック要素でレイアウトをいじってたんだけど、
このときのwidthがdiv枠の幅じゃなくてdiv枠からpaddingの値を引いた値(内容物の幅)になるんだね!!
今までdiv枠全体の幅だと思ってたよorz
しかもIEだとdiv枠全体の幅と解釈されるらしいのでHTMLソースの先頭できちんとDOCTYPEを指定してやら無いといけないらしい。
う~~~ん・・・・奥が深い;;